Ohio's climate, characterized by distinct warm, humid summers and cold, wet winters, creates a perpetual cycle conducive to mold and mildew proliferation. High humidity levels, particularly during the warmer months, combined with potential for condensation in poorly ventilated areas during colder periods, necessitate proactive and thorough remediation strategies. Lysol wipes are designed for surface disinfection and may kill some surface mold spores upon direct contact. However, they are not a substitute for professional mold remediation. For significant mold infestations, especially those embedded within porous materials, a comprehensive removal process is required to address the entire affected substrate and underlying moisture source, which Lysol cannot achieve.
Complete eradication of all mold spores from an environment is practically impossible, as spores are ubiquitous in nature. The goal of professional mold remediation, as performed in Cincinnati and throughout Ohio, is to reduce the mold spore count to pre-existing, safe levels. This involves removing visible mold growth and addressing the moisture issues that allowed it to thrive, preventing recurrence.
Achieving permanent mold removal involves a two-pronged strategy: meticulous removal of all affected materials and, critically, permanent elimination of the moisture source. Without addressing the underlying water or humidity problem, mold will inevitably return. Avoid using household cleaning products like standard bleach or vinegar on porous materials without proper containment and ventilation, as they may not effectively kill mold roots and can spread spores. Furthermore, never attempt to dry-scrape or sand moldy surfaces, as this aerosolizes spores, significantly worsening the problem. Professional containment and removal are paramount for effective treatment.
Both bleach and vinegar can kill certain types of surface mold under specific conditions. However, neither is a guaranteed permanent solution for all mold issues, especially when mold has penetrated porous materials.
